EPLA material

EPLA material, often referred to as "Enhanced PLA", is a modified version of the standard PLA or polylactic acid printing material. The "E" in the name refers to the enhanced properties, especially the higher toughness and impact resistance. While conventional PLA is relatively brittle and breaks easily when bent or impacted, EPLA is designed to be more flexible and less prone to breakage. This is achieved by modifying the chemical composition of the base material, which also improves the adhesion between the printed layers, increasing the overall strength of the print. In terms of the 3D printing process, EPLA behaves very similarly to conventional PLA, printing at comparable temperatures and requiring no special printer setup. It is used for printing functional parts, mechanical components or models where higher mechanical durability is required, but at the same time the ease of printability that is typical of PLA materials is emphasized.
